The Impact of School Expulsion on Mental Health

Schools are intended to be safe havens for learning and development. Unfortunately, when a child is expelled, it can send shockwaves through their lives, leading to feelings of isolation, anxiety, and confusion. Experts have noted that expulsion can significantly impact a child’s self-esteem and mental health, an aspect that Jenny highlighted in her emotional response.

- Emotional Distress: Children who experience expulsion may become withdrawn and struggle with feelings of shame or embarrassment.
- Academic Setbacks: Losing access to education can lead to significant gaps in learning, affecting a child’s long-term academic success.
- Increased Anxiety: The uncertainty of their future after expulsion can cause heightened anxiety and stress.

Creating Solutions to Help Children Thrive

As more stories like Jenny’s surface, there is an urgent need for schools and parents to work together to develop more humane and effective disciplinary practices. Educational institutions can implement restorative justice programs that focus on resolving conflicts and addressing underlying issues rather than resorting to expulsion as a first option. These solutions not only help in maintaining a child’s dignity but also contribute to a positive school climate.

- Restorative Practices: Teaching children how to resolve conflicts and understand the consequences of their actions can reduce the need for extreme measures like expulsion.
- Flexible Learning Environments: Alternatives that allow students to continue learning outside of traditional classrooms can prevent the negative impacts of sudden expulsion.
- Parental Engagement: Schools and families must collaborate to support children during challenging times and seek behavioral interventions before expulsion becomes necessary.

The importance of empathy and understanding in addressing behavioral issues cannot be overstated. By fostering open discussions among educators, parents, and mental health professionals, communities can work toward creating supportive pathways for children facing challenges in the school setting.
